In an exclusive interview with fcinternews.it the great Inter idol Marco Materazzi talked about Inter’s current team, Erick Thohir’s arrival and his best memories together with the current honorary president of Inter Massimo Moratti and finished by paying tribute to the fans he loved so much over the years of victories in Inter’s colors. Below is the full interview with Inter’s number 23 who became champion of Europe and the world with Inter.

Materazzi, for starters, will you be present at the match against Sampdoria on Sunday and accept Thohir’s invitation?

“Yes, I think so.”

Will you greet Curva Nord before the game and strengthen the Inter supporters?

“I will greet my fans with great joy, but it will be the team that strengthens the Inter supporters with a great victory.”

Regarding Thohir, what do you think about Indonesian’s entry into the club?

“From what I have seen, it appears that his intent is to match everything the president Moratti has done.”

Massimo Moratti and Marco Materazzi: your memory of the president.

“I think he is unique for everything the Moratti family has done in general. What the president has done is unique, no one has succeeded with what he has done during Inter’s history.”

Looking at the progress of the team, how would you assess Inter’s performance in the league so far?

“The team is doing well, they have made mistakes in some games but the important thing is the mentality, even if there isn’t the same quality as in the past years.”

How do you assess the work that Walter Mazzarri does?

“The coach gets the best out of each player and that’s not easy. Getting everyone to give 110 percent is a difficult thing and he has always done that throughout his career. Inter, with him, has performed beyond expectations. It’s shown by the fact that the same Napoli, who in my opinion have the best team in the league, only have two points more than Inter.”

Finally, a greeting to the Inter fans. Marco Materazzi’s message to them.

“I can say that I miss my fans more than they miss me. Thank you all for the life you gave me.”
